Semantics-based Automated Web Testing
We present TAO, a software testing tool performing automated test and oracle
generation based on a semantic approach. TAO entangles grammar-based test
generation with automated semantics evaluation using a denotational semantics
framework. We show how TAO can be incorporated with the Selenium automation
tool for automated web testing, and how TAO can be further extended to support
automated delta debugging, where a failing web test script can be
systematically reduced based on grammar-directed strategies. A real-life
parking website is adopted throughout the paper to demonstrate the effectivity
of our semantics-based web testing approach.Comment: In Proceedings WWV 2015, arXiv:1508.0338
Metamodel Instance Generation: A systematic literature review
Modelling and thus metamodelling have become increasingly important in
Software Engineering through the use of Model Driven Engineering. In this paper
we present a systematic literature review of instance generation techniques for
metamodels, i.e. the process of automatically generating models from a given
metamodel. We start by presenting a set of research questions that our review
is intended to answer. We then identify the main topics that are related to
metamodel instance generation techniques, and use these to initiate our
literature search. This search resulted in the identification of 34 key papers
in the area, and each of these is reviewed here and discussed in detail. The
outcome is that we are able to identify a knowledge gap in this field, and we
offer suggestions as to some potential directions for future research.Comment: 25 page
IEEE Standard 1500 Compliance Verification for Embedded Cores
Core-based design and reuse are the two key elements for an efficient system-on-chip (SoC) development. Unfortunately, they also introduce new challenges in SoC testing, such as core test reuse and the need of a common test infrastructure working with cores originating from different vendors. The IEEE 1500 Standard for Embedded Core Testing addresses these issues by proposing a flexible hardware test wrapper architecture for embedded cores, together with a core test language (CTL) used to describe the implemented wrapper functionalities. Several intellectual property providers have already announced IEEE Standard 1500 compliance in both existing and future design blocks. In this paper, we address the problem of guaranteeing the compliance of a wrapper architecture and its CTL description to the IEEE Standard 1500. This step is mandatory to fully trust the wrapper functionalities in applying the test sequences to the core. We present a systematic methodology to build a verification framework for IEEE Standard 1500 compliant cores, allowing core providers and/or integrators to verify the compliance of their products (sold or purchased) to the standar
Ontology-driven conceptual modeling: A'systematic literature mapping and review

Ontology-driven conceptual modeling (ODCM) is still a relatively new research domain in the field of information systems and there is still much discussion on how the research in ODCM should be performed and what the focus of this research should be. Therefore, this article aims to critically survey the existing literature in order to assess the kind of research that has been performed over the years, analyze the nature of the research contributions and establish its current state of the art by positioning, evaluating and interpreting relevant research to date that is related to ODCM. To understand and identify any gaps and research opportunities, our literature study is composed of both a systematic mapping study and a systematic review study. The mapping study aims at structuring and classifying the area that is being investigated in order to give a general overview of the research that has been performed in the field. A review study on the other hand is a more thorough and rigorous inquiry and provides recommendations based on the strength of the found evidence. Our results indicate that there are several research gaps that should be addressed and we further composed several research opportunities that are possible areas for future research

Educational cultural analysis of language assessment rubrics: a case study of Japanese language at a British University
The standard of language assessment is considered to be similar within the same country, but it actually varies from institution to institution even within the UK. Rubrics are important for language teachers to access students' written work, and it also relates to teachers' objective or subjective marking. This paper looks at Japanese assessment criteria in a British STEM university where students study Japanese in the IWLP context. Using two dimensions from Hofstede et al.'s (2010) cultural taxonomy and Hall's (1976) concept of high- and low-context culture, Japanese language rubrics for the written assessment was analysed in 2017. The findings show that the rubrics examined in this study were under the influence of Hofstede et al.'s (2010) collectivist and strong uncertainty avoidance educational culture. The emphasis on the correct use of grammar was observed and also found that language teachers in this institution grade students' written work more objectively using quantitative method. The rubrics includes instructions which enhance the quality of grading consistent and standardise among all language teachers. This process also helps to justify the first marker's awarded marks to the second marker and also the external examiner. Recommendations are given to language teachers and managers who coordinate languages. Language teachers are recommended to inform students whether the focus is accuracy or creativity as this information affects students in working on their assessed work. It is also recommended for managers at language centres to revise periodically the definition of categories to examine if there are any duplication among the rubrics and update them. Incorporating some aspects of rubrics mentioned in this study may enhance the quality of language teachers' grading to be standardised and consistent
